NS Socio-economic Classfication (15 way) 2001 2011 2021
Employers in large establishments 85 Show data context 930 Show data context 34 Show data context
Higher managerial & administrative occupations 1,208 Show data context 2,510 Show data context 1,769 Show data context
Higher professional occupations 1,236 Show data context 7,169 Show data context 3,721 Show data context
Lower professional & higher technical occupations 3,224 Show data context 4,379 Show data context 5,577 Show data context
Lower managerial & administrative occupations 1,933 Show data context 1,846 Show data context 2,045 Show data context
Higher supervisory occupations 884 Show data context 944 Show data context 1,136 Show data context
Intermediate occupations 3,178 Show data context 4,752 Show data context 5,228 Show data context
Employers in small organisations 774 Show data context 738 Show data context 844 Show data context
Own account workers 1,453 Show data context 2,345 Show data context 3,402 Show data context
Lower supervisory occupations 1,722 Show data context 1,375 Show data context 1,124 Show data context
Lower technical occupations 1,082 Show data context 1,306 Show data context 1,514 Show data context
Semi-routine occupations 3,800 Show data context 4,601 Show data context 4,905 Show data context
Routine occupations 4,402 Show data context 4,959 Show data context 6,207 Show data context
Never worked & long-term unemployed 544 Show data context 1,050 Show data context 2,506 Show data context
Full-time students 1,552 Show data context 1,820 Show data context 1,891 Show data context
Date Source
2001 Office for National Statistics, NOMIS - Official Census and Labour Market Statistics (Table UV031, NS-Sec (21 way))
2011 Office for National Statistics, NOMIS - Official Census and Labour Market Statistics (Table QS607UK - NS-SeC)
2021 Office for National Statistics, ONS "Create a Custom Dataset" (National Statistics Socio-economic Classification (17 way))
